Reports in Britain claim Radja Nainggolan is a Chelsea target, but the Roma man “hasn’t talked to any club”.

The London Evening Standard reported today that the English side were looking to bring the Belgian international to Stamford Bridge this summer in a £35m [€44m] transfer, as expected new manager Antonio Conte is an admirer.

It was claimed that Nainggolan had told friends he was considering a move to the Premier League, but the player himself has denied those claims.

“I haven’t talked to any club,” Nainggolan posted on his official Twitter profile.

“Why would I discuss that with my friends? Forza Roma, and Forza Belgium for tonight!”

Belgium face Portugal tonight in Leiria, with the game moved after the terror attacks in Brussels.
